葡萄的生长发育易受非生物胁迫的影响。为探究一些物质在抵御葡萄非生物胁迫中的作用,总结了生物刺激素、植物生长调节剂、内源性保护物质、外源调节物质和抗氧化物质等在提高葡萄非生物胁迫耐受性中的机制,重点讨论了以上物质在促进葡萄根系生长、激素平衡和抗氧化系统方面的潜力,强调了信号传导、抗氧化酶和非酶抗氧化剂通过清除ROS,提高了葡萄对非生物胁迫耐受性的机制。

[Abstract]
The growth and development of grapes are susceptible to abiotic stress. To summarize the role of some substances in resisting grape abiotic stress, this review mainly discusses the mechanism of biological stimulants, plant growth regulators, endogenous and exogenous protective substances, antioxidant substances, etc., in improving grape abiotic stress tolerance. It focuses on the potential of the aforementioned substances in promoting grape root growth, hormone balance, and the antioxidant system, emphasizing the mechanisms by which signaling pathways, antioxidant enzymes, and non-enzymatic antioxidants enhance grape tolerance to abiotic stress by scavenging ROS.
